MOSCOW, December 17 (R-Sport) – KHL teams want to extend the regular ice-hockey season to 60 games, league vice-president Vladimir Shalaev said Tuesday. The move would add six games to the competition but would still leave the league well behind the NHL in North America, where the regular season is 82 games. “We are talking about 60 games, as the discussion is based around this figure,” Shalaev said after a meeting of club directors. “All teams want to play approximately this many games in a regular season.
